Byron Arnold, Jr., age 87, of Campbellsville, passed away at 4:10 a.m., Tuesday, July 23, 2019 at the Hosparus Inpatient Care Center in Louisville.
A native of Washington County, he was born on March 24, 1932 to the late William Byron and Arene Shewmaker Arnold.
He was a member of the First Baptist Church in Irvine, KY, a 1950 graduate of Irvine High School and a graduate of Eastern Kentucky College. He served in the United States Air Force stationed in Germany. He worked as a customs agent in New Jersey until his retirement.
